Frank, yes it's on 3 CDs. The date was originally released on 2 separate CDs, "Sunday at the Village Vanguard", and "Waltz for Debbie". The box set differs mainly in that it presents the music in the order it was performed, and contains a couple of extra takes. |

Frank, I'm thinking I might try and find some of that music on vinyl as well. I am thinking those earlier recordings, particularly in a live setting, may be better reproduced in that medium. I mean they literally hauled a reel-to-reel deck down there and set it on one of the tables on June 25, 1961 and let 'er fly. What you saw was what you got. Something special about that, though. The late Bill Evans recordings that I've heard (ca 1977 through 1980) sound very good on CD to my ear. |
